Professional Background

Kristine Espinosa is a seasoned IT Director with over a decade of experience in the consumer goods sector. Her journey through the realms of technology and design has uniquely positioned her as a multifaceted leader capable of bridging the gap between artistry and engineering. Currently, Kristine serves as the Operations Leader for Digital Tools & Solutions at Procter & Gamble, where her expertise in IT service management and operations has led to significant enhancements in operational efficiency and innovation within the organization.

Throughout her career at Procter & Gamble, Kristine has held various pivotal roles that have allowed her to hone her skills in project and program management. From her beginnings as an Associate Service Manager for Packaging Artwork Global to climbing the ranks as the Innovation Delivery Leader for Flow Global, Kristine has consistently demonstrated her ability to deliver results in high-pressure environments.

In addition to her corporate role, Kristine is also a passionate creative. She is the former Owner and Creative Director at Worth the Wait Creative Studio, where she applied her design thinking principles to help brands tell their stories more effectively. Her experience as a mentor and coach at IDEO U further showcases her dedication to fostering creativity and innovation in others, allowing her to inspire the next generation of thinkers and creators.

Education and Achievements

Kristine Espinosa earned her Bachelor of Science in Computer Engineering from the esteemed University of the Philippines Diliman, where she specialized in Mobile Robotics. This educational background not only provided her with a solid technical foundation but also instilled in her the importance of innovation and creative problem-solving—a blend she refers to as “thinking like an engineer” while maintaining “the vision of an artist.”
